config RISCV_ISA_V_PREEMPTIVE
bool "Run kernel-mode Vector with kernel preemption"
depends on PREEMPTION
depends on RISCV_ISA_V
default y
help
Usually, in-kernel SIMD routines are run with preemption disabled.
Functions which envoke long running SIMD thus must yield core's
vector unit to prevent blocking other tasks for too long.

This config allows kernel to run SIMD without explicitly disable
preemption. Enabling this config will result in higher memory
consumption due to the allocation of per-task's kernel Vector context.

/*
* We use a flag to track in-kernel Vector context. Currently the flag has the
* following meaning:
*
* - bit 0: indicates whether the in-kernel Vector context is active. The
* activation of this state disables the preemption. On a non-RT kernel, it
* also disable bh.
* - bits 8: is used for tracking preemptible kernel-mode Vector, when
* RISCV_ISA_V_PREEMPTIVE is enabled. Calling kernel_vector_begin() does not
* disable the preemption if the thread's kernel_vstate.datap is allocated.
* Instead, the kernel set this bit field. Then the trap entry/exit code
* knows if we are entering/exiting the context that owns preempt_v.
* - 0: the task is not using preempt_v
* - 1: the task is actively using preempt_v. But whether does the task own
* the preempt_v context is decided by bits in RISCV_V_CTX_DEPTH_MASK.
* - bit 16-23 are RISCV_V_CTX_DEPTH_MASK, used by context tracking routine
* when preempt_v starts:
* - 0: the task is actively using, and own preempt_v context.
* - non-zero: the task was using preempt_v, but then took a trap within.
* Thus, the task does not own preempt_v. Any use of Vector will have to
* save preempt_v, if dirty, and fallback to non-preemptible kernel-mode
* Vector.
* - bit 30: The in-kernel preempt_v context is saved, and requries to be
* restored when returning to the context that owns the preempt_v.
* - bit 31: The in-kernel preempt_v context is dirty, as signaled by the
* trap entry code. Any context switches out-of current task need to save
* it to the task's in-kernel V context. Also, any traps nesting on-top-of
* preempt_v requesting to use V needs a save.
*/
#define RISCV_V_CTX_DEPTH_MASK 0x00ff0000

#define RISCV_V_CTX_UNIT_DEPTH 0x00010000
#define RISCV_KERNEL_MODE_V 0x00000001
#define RISCV_PREEMPT_V 0x00000100
#define RISCV_PREEMPT_V_DIRTY 0x80000000
#define RISCV_PREEMPT_V_NEED_RESTORE 0x40000000

#ifdef CONFIG_RISCV_ISA_V
/*
* may_use_simd - whether it is allowable at this time to issue vector
* instructions or access the vector register file
*
* Callers must not assume that the result remains true beyond the next
* preempt_enable() or return from softirq context.
*/
static __must_check inline bool may_use_simd(void)
{
/*
* RISCV_KERNEL_MODE_V is only set while preemption is disabled,
* and is clear whenever preemption is enabled.
*/
if (in_hardirq() || in_nmi())
return false;

/*
* Nesting is acheived in preempt_v by spreading the control for
* preemptible and non-preemptible kernel-mode Vector into two fields.
* Always try to match with prempt_v if kernel V-context exists. Then,
* fallback to check non preempt_v if nesting happens, or if the config
* is not set.
*/
if (IS_ENABLED(CONFIG_RISCV_ISA_V_PREEMPTIVE) && current->thread.kernel_vstate.datap) {
if (!riscv_preempt_v_started(current))
return true;
}
/*
* Non-preemptible kernel-mode Vector temporarily disables bh. So we
* must not return true on irq_disabled(). Otherwise we would fail the
* lockdep check calling local_bh_enable()
*/
return !irqs_disabled() && !(riscv_v_flags() & RISCV_KERNEL_MODE_V);
}

#else /* ! CONFIG_RISCV_ISA_V */

static __must_check inline bool may_use_simd(void)
{
return false;
}

#endif /* ! CONFIG_RISCV_ISA_V */
